Transaction 6ba472357827d04aa574bd031378a1fa623c5e986ed6a6bfbc0ea684b4cfe06c
1 Input
1 Output
-
6ba472357827d04aa574bd031378a1fa623c5e986ed6a6bfbc0ea684b4cfe06c:0
- value
- 70817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8db42970577fff569eb0269ad72e01a182c93197 OP_EQUAL
- address
- 3EcH2TX9e1WizwCmcb9G7F5uqxaM69UF1V